AdvancedWebView

Advanced WebView component for Android that works as intended out of the box

Works on Android 2.2+ (API level 8 and above)

Installation

  • Include one of the JARs in your libs folder
  • or
  • Copy the Java package to your project's source folder
  • or
  • Create a new library project from this repository and reference it in your project

Usage

AndroidManifest.xml

<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.INTERNET" />

Layout (XML)

<im.delight.android.webview.AdvancedWebView
    android:id="@+id/webview"
    android:layout_width="match_parent"
    android:layout_height="match_parent" />

Activity (Java)

Without Fragments

public class MyActivity extends Activity implements AdvancedWebView.Listener {

    private AdvancedWebView mWebView;

    @Override
    protected void onCreate(Bundle savedInstanceState) {
        super.onCreate(savedInstanceState);
        setContentView(R.layout.activity_my);

        mWebView = (AdvancedWebView) findViewById(R.id.webview);
        mWebView.setListener(this, this);
        mWebView.loadUrl("http://www.example.org/");

        // ...
    }

    @SuppressLint("NewApi")
    @Override
    protected void onResume() {
        super.onResume();
        mWebView.onResume();
        // ...
    }

    @SuppressLint("NewApi")
    @Override
    protected void onPause() {
        mWebView.onPause();
        // ...
        super.onPause();
    }

    @Override
    protected void onDestroy() {
        mWebView.onDestroy();
        // ...
        super.onDestroy();
    }

    @Override
    protected void onActivityResult(int requestCode, int resultCode, Intent intent) {
        super.onActivityResult(requestCode, resultCode, intent);
        mWebView.onActivityResult(requestCode, resultCode, intent);
        // ...
    }

    @Override
    public void onBackPressed() {
        if (!mWebView.onBackPressed()) { return; }
        // ...
        super.onBackPressed();
    }

    @Override
    public void onPageStarted(String url, Bitmap favicon) { }

    @Override
    public void onPageFinished(String url) { }

    @Override
    public void onPageError(int errorCode, String description, String failingUrl) { }

    @Override
    public void onDownloadRequested(String url, String userAgent, String contentDisposition, String mimetype, long contentLength) { }

    @Override
    public void onExternalPageRequest(String url) { }

}

With Fragments

public class MyFragment extends Fragment implements AdvancedWebView.Listener {

    private AdvancedWebView mWebView;

    public MyFragment() { }

    @Override
    public View onCreateView(LayoutInflater inflater, ViewGroup container, Bundle savedInstanceState) {
        View rootView = inflater.inflate(R.layout.fragment_my, container, false);

        mWebView = (AdvancedWebView) rootView.findViewById(R.id.webview);
        mWebView.setListener(this, this);
        mWebView.loadUrl("http://www.example.org/");

        // ...

        return rootView;
    }

    @SuppressLint("NewApi")
    @Override
    public void onResume() {
        super.onResume();
        mWebView.onResume();
        // ...
    }

    @SuppressLint("NewApi")
    @Override
    public void onPause() {
        mWebView.onPause();
        // ...
        super.onPause();
    }

    @Override
    public void onDestroy() {
        mWebView.onDestroy();
        // ...
        super.onDestroy();
    }

    @Override
    public void onActivityResult(int requestCode, int resultCode, Intent intent) {
        super.onActivityResult(requestCode, resultCode, intent);
        mWebView.onActivityResult(requestCode, resultCode, intent);
        // ...
    }

    @Override
    public void onPageStarted(String url, Bitmap favicon) { }

    @Override
    public void onPageFinished(String url) { }

    @Override
    public void onPageError(int errorCode, String description, String failingUrl) { }

    @Override
    public void onDownloadRequested(String url, String userAgent, String contentDisposition, String mimetype, long contentLength) { }

    @Override
    public void onExternalPageRequest(String url) { }

}

ProGuard (if enabled)

-keep class * extends android.webkit.WebChromeClient { *; }
-dontwarn im.delight.android.webview.**

Features

  • Optimized for best performance and security
  • Features are patched across Android versions
  • File uploads are handled automatically (check availability withAdvancedWebView.isFileUploadAvailable())
  • JavaScript and WebStorage are enabled by default
  • Includes localizations for the 25 most widely spoken languages
  • Receive callbacks when pages start/finish loading or have errors

    @Override
    public void onPageStarted(String url, Bitmap favicon) {
       // a new page started loading
    }
    
    @Override
    public void onPageFinished(String url) {
       // the new page finished loading
    }
    
    @Override
    public void onPageError(int errorCode, String description, String failingUrl) {
       // the new page failed to load
    }
    
  • Downloads are handled automatically and can be listened to

    @Override
    public void onDownloadRequested(String url, String userAgent, String contentDisposition, String mimetype, long contentLength) {
       // some file is available for download
       // either handle the download yourself or use the code below
    
       final String filename;
       // ...
    
       if (AdvancedWebView.handleDownload(this, url, filename)) {
           // download successfully handled
       }
       else {
           // download couldn't be handled because user has disabled download manager app on the device
           // TODO show some notice to the user
       }
    }
    
  • Enable geolocation support (needs <uses-permission android:name="android.permission.ACCESS_FINE_LOCATION" />)

    mWebView.setGeolocationEnabled(true);
    
  • Add custom HTTP headers in addition to the ones sent by the web browser implementation

    mWebView.addHttpHeader("X-Requested-With", "My wonderful app");
    
  • Define a custom set of permitted hostnames and receive callbacks for all other hostnames

    mWebView.addPermittedHostname("www.example.org");
    

    and

    @Override
    public void onExternalPageRequest(String url) {
       // the user tried to open a page from a non-permitted hostname
    }
    
  • Prevent caching of HTML pages

    boolean preventCaching = true;
    mWebView.loadUrl("http://www.example.org/", preventCaching);
    
  • Check for alternative browsers installed on the device

    if (AdvancedWebView.Browsers.hasAlternative(this)) {
       AdvancedWebView.Browsers.openUrl(this, "http://www.example.org/");
    }
    
  • Disable cookies

    // disable third-party cookies only
    mWebView.setThirdPartyCookiesEnabled(false);
    // or disable cookies in general
    mWebView.setCookiesEnabled(false);
    
  • Disallow mixed content (HTTP content being loaded inside HTTPS sites)

    mWebView.setMixedContentAllowed(false);
